Great Little Car
I'm single with a medium sized dog- We both love the car. I bought a salvage title (from small accident) and stole this guy at almost half price !! Mine only has 15k miles and I've only driven 1500 of that, so it's early on for a review, but I can't find fault anywhere. There's one detail I'll mention- I like to sit up a little higher and I'm 6-3, so I use a foam pad. I don't like sitting down inside a car and prefer to be on top of things. New note- Don't like the suspension- It's cheap and doesn't hold the road well. Headlights also way too low ar factory setting

Flawed design disables Cruise Control & other
Bought this Hyundai brand new in 2013 for my daughter's college car after test driving a few other hatch backs such as Mazda 3 and Honda. The value appeared to be there but after 5 years we are realizing the car is NOT as good as Japanese made cars that we have owned!! In fact, the poorly designed of Horn squeezes the Connector for the Cruise Control and it has stopped working! I believe this design has not disabled the Air Bag circuit with the Air-Bag indicator light is now ON all the time. This is a serious safety issue and since the Air Bag would not deploy during an accident. In short, Hyundai's "poor design" and "cheap materials" to keep the cost down which has impacted the overall quality of the car. We very much doubt we will buy another Hyundai and won't recommend it.

Average car, Nothing Special
Good car for the money. Great for getting around the city and parking. Quality interior. Not very comfortable for long trips on highway. Front brake rotors rusted badly and were making noise. Was told by Hyundai that rotors rusting is not covered under their warranty, car had only 32,000 miles. Brake rotors should not rust that badly with that mileage. Bought aftermarket rotors with coating and have had no further rust problems. Hyundai brake rotors have bad rating on internet for premature rust and warping. Mileage is poor for a car that small. My wife likes it but I would never buy another. There are much better choices out there like the new Mazda 3 hatchback and the Honda Civic hatch back. They are much better cars for the money.
